WebThe traditional bridal dress for Libyan women is called a ‘hasira’. The hasira is made out of white silk, and beautifully embroidered and embellished with silver and gold thread. The bride also wears a veil of the same silk decorated with gold adornments. Gold jewellery is worn, with heavy neck pieces often reaching the knees and extending ...
